Enochs suffered their closest loss since March 23rd on Monday. They fell just short of the Turlock Bulldogs by a score of 6-4. The Eagles haven't had much luck with the Bulldogs recently, as the team has come up short the last six times they've met.
Enochs saw seven different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Christian Fannin, who went 2-for-3 with one run and one RBI. Bryan Delgado was another, getting on base in three of his four plate appearances with one stolen base and one run.
Enochs' defeat dropped their record down to 10-10. As for Turlock,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 11 of their last 12 matchups. That's provided a nice bump to their 14-5 record this season.
While Enochs had to take the loss, they won't have to wait long to give it another shot: the pair's next game is a rematch scheduled at 4:00 p.m. on Wednesday.
